Adelaide Hills Roadside Stalls Tea Towel
Hand illustrated by Chris Edser
The Adelaide Hills roadside stalls are the heart of this artwork. Every honesty box, bunch of flowers, tray of fruit and little corner of character has been illustrated with care. The piece is filled with fine detail drawn directly from the stalls themselves, so you can keep a little of that roadside magic in your home.
Hand illustrated by acclaimed local illustrator Chris Edser, the artwork also includes subtle nods to the wider Hills landscape. The birds are all local species including the Adelaide Rosella, Grey Fantail and Eastern Spinebill. There is a gum tree inspired by one near the Kids of the Glen Corner Store, the Gumeracha Rocking Horse, the reservoir near Gorge Road, Greenhill Road climbing out of the city, the Mount Lofty towers, pine trees and a mushroom near Kuitpo Forest and a small church at Strathalbyn. These details sit quietly around the main illustrations, adding depth without taking focus away from the stalls.
